Yesterday I talked to some members of the Danish Iceland-collectors
Club and they say: No, you cant have a black overprint - it's always
red as Blair found for us.

I have now taken a few photos of the overprint with my brand new
Traveller USB-microscope (about 30 euros in the ALDI shop):

http://www.norbyhus.dk/artiklermm/di...r/hopflug.html

Now I'm not in doubt : it's a faked overprint made by photocopy and
it's easy to see the coal grains.

Others have confirmed what I was about to say, namely that
a black overprint is not in SG, and the images posted certainly confirm
that.

General Balbo's adventures certainly created a lot of expensive
stamps!

I have had the good fortune to acquire another Italian triptych
pair at a very reasonable price. 4 pilots acquired plus an odd stamp,
leaving only 15 and a half pairs to get (a friend has just acquired the last
in
the set after several years trying).

See http://www.italianstamps.co.uk/kingd...ail/index.html
for a nice block (I have another similar block for the other denomination).

Even at the time having 20 copies of each denomination caused an uproar
in the philatelic press due to the total cost of 1500 lire at a time when an
ordinary air letter cost 1.25 lire.
